Letter: Superintendent doesn’t merit passing grade

Monday, Feb. 18, 2002 | 8:35 a.m.

Hate to rain on Carlos Garcia's parade, but before he rides off into new school district sunsets, would someone please remind the superintendent of schools:

A) He was Clark County's fifth or sixth choice to fill his position a few years back, and when chosen was from the "leftover pool"!

B) His racial "slur" made during the first six months on the job was close to a keg of dynamite igniting, and is still vivid in many of our minds.

C) His "privatization" of some seven local schools, and his choice of Edison to run them was very behind closed doors, and many local parents and taxpayers are still questioning this decision.

D) His most recent proposal to ban smoking in all schools for teachers is absurd. I mean, is it also their fault that they're already overworked in overcrowded classrooms, underpaid and understaffed? Mr. Garcia's marketing and public relations skills need a lot of work before he rides off into new school district sunsets.

At this point he won't get passing grades from this taxpayer nor a reference on his updated resume.
